This pool installer increased their minimum project size from $90,000 to $185,000 within 2 years.
When this client first came to us in 2017, they were looking to increase their call volume. After quickly getting them the number of calls they wanted, they realized they did not have the time to call every prospective client. In addition, this pool installer did not want to expand their team and do more projects. They wanted to grow by increasing the average project size.
With increasing costs of pay-per-click advertising and fierce competition in the area, we came up with a strategy combining SEO, paid social media, and display. As the ability to segment a Facebook audience based on key demographics was eliminated, we relied on past data and customers to generate custom audiences that allowed us to laser-focus on the target customer for this pool installer.
People were finding the website organically and submitting their information, but a lot of them still weren’t a good fit. We didn’t want to prevent prospective buyers from contacting this pool installer client, so the main contact form was left unchanged. To help people self-filter, leads were emailed a survey [after submitting their info] that was required for contact. We developed key questions with the client that would help identify best fits and filter out poor fits. Poor fits were thanked and e-mailed to allow time to focus on the best fits.
Within two years of implementing the survey, this pool installer increased their minimum project size from $90,000 to $185,000.
They are still doing the same amount projects per year, maintaining their reputation as a boutique custom pool builder.
